HTML+CSS实现导航条下拉菜单的示例代码


Posted in HTML / CSS onAugust 02, 2021

效果

代码中的图片可以自己换的

HTML+CSS实现导航条下拉菜单的示例代码

下拉菜单HTML代码

<header class="header">
        <div class="header_left">
            <img src="img/logo.jpg">
        </div>
        <div class="header_right">
                <div class="number_right">
                    <img src="img/number.jpg">
                </div>
                <ul>
                    <a href="#"><li>首页</li></a>
                    <a href="#"><li class="show_list">
                        <span>成功案例</span>
                        <ul class="move_list">
                            <li>品牌设计</li>
                            <li>网页设计</li>
                            <li>平面设计</li>
                            <li>电子商城</li>
                            <li>空间/建筑</li>
                        </ul>
                    </li></a>
                    <a href="#"><li>我要设计</li></a>
                    <a href="#"><li>在线咨询</li></a>
                    <a href="#"><li>会员注册</li></a>
                    <a href="#"><li>会员登录</li></a>
                </ul>
        </div>
    </header>

下拉菜单CSS代码

.header{
    height: 120px;
    width: 1046px;
    margin: 0 auto;
}
.header_left{
    float: left;
    line-height: 120px;

}
.header_left img{
    width: 300px;
    height: 100px;
}
.header_right{
    float: right;
    height: 120px;
    position: relative;
}
.header_right>div{
    position: absolute;
    top: 0;
    right: 0;

}
.header_right ul{
    margin-top: 88px;

}
.header_right ul a li{
    border-right: 1px solid #000000;
    height: 13px;
    font-size: 15px;
    padding: 0 25px;
    font-weight: bold;
    color: #666;

}
.header_right ul a{
    float: left;
    line-height: 13px;

}
.header_right ul a li:hover{
    color: #000000;
}
.header_right ul a:last-child li{/*去掉最后的边框*/
    border: none;
}
.show_list{
    position: relative;
}
.show_list .move_list{
    display: none;
    z-index: 103;
    position: absolute;
    top: -56px;
    left: 0;
    width: 100%;
    background: #333;
    text-align: center;
}
.show_list .move_list li{
    padding: 10px 0;
    width: 114px;
    color: #fff;
}
.header_right ul a .show_list{
    padding-bottom: 20px;
    border-right: none;
}
.show_list:hover .move_list{
    display: block;
}
.header_right ul a:nth-child(3){
    border-left: 1px solid #000;
}
.show_list .move_list li:hover{
    color: white;
    background: orange;
}

在写完上述代码的同时须加上css的重置代码,代码如下:

* {
    margin: 0;
    padding: 0
}
em,i {
    font-style: normal
}
li {
    list-style: none
}
a{
    font: 14px/24px Microsoft YaHei,Arial,\\5B8B\4F53,Arial Narrow;
    letter-spacing: 1.2px;
    color: #666;
    text-decoration: none
}
a:hover {
    color: #c81623 ;
}

img {
    border: 0;
    vertical-align: middle
}
input{
    outline: none;
}
button {
    cursor: pointer;
    border:none;
    outline: none;
}

到此这篇关于HTML+CSS实现导航条下拉菜单的示例代码的文章就介绍到这了,更多相关HTML+CSS导航条下拉菜单内容请搜索三水点靠木以前的文章或继续浏览下面的相关文章,希望大家以后多多支持三水点靠木!

 
HTML / CSS 相关文章推荐
CSS3实现粒子旋转伸缩加载动画
Apr 22 HTML / CSS
CSS3 制作旋转的大风车(充满童年回忆)
Jan 30 HTML / CSS
CSS Grid布局教程之网格单元格布局
Dec 30 HTML / CSS
CSS中的字体大小设置属性总结
May 24 HTML / CSS
CSS3 rgb and rgba(透明色)的使用详解
Sep 25 HTML / CSS
html5嵌入内容_动力节点Java学院整理
Jul 07 HTML / CSS
详解HTML5 canvas绘图基本使用方法
Jan 29 HTML / CSS
Html5 audio标签样式的修改
Jan 28 HTML / CSS
HTML5实现多张图片上传功能
Mar 11 HTML / CSS
使用HTML5 Canvas绘制圆角矩形及相关的一些应用举例
Mar 22 HTML / CSS
HTML5 canvas基本绘图之图形变换
Jun 27 HTML / CSS
html5中audio支持音频格式的解决方法
Aug 24 HTML / CSS
CSS实现两列布局的N种方法
Aug 02 #HTML / CSS
html+css实现滚动到元素位置显示加载动画效果
Aug 02 #HTML / CSS
纯html+css实现打字效果
html form表单基础入门案例讲解
Jul 21 #HTML / CSS
带你了解CSS基础知识,样式
Jul 21 #HTML / CSS
CSS实现隐藏搜索框功能(动画正反向序列)
Jul 21 #HTML / CSS
详解CSS3.0(Cascading Style Sheet) 层叠级联样式表
You might like
解析php中的fopen()函数用打开文件模式说明
2013/06/20 PHP
PHP Ajax实现无刷新附件上传
2016/08/17 PHP
根据鼠标的位置动态的控制层的位置
2009/11/24 Javascript
变量声明时命名与变量作为对象属性时命名的区别解析
2013/12/06 Javascript
封装好的js判断操作系统与浏览器代码分享
2015/01/09 Javascript
详解AngularJS中的作用域
2015/06/17 Javascript
javascript瀑布流布局实现方法详解
2016/02/17 Javascript
谈一谈js中的执行环境及作用域
2016/03/30 Javascript
基于javascript bootstrap实现生日日期联动选择
2016/04/07 Javascript
jQuery中队列queue()函数的实例教程
2016/05/03 Javascript
JS/jquery实现一个网页内同时调用多个倒计时的方法
2017/04/27 jQuery
使用 Vue 绑定单个或多个 Class 名的实例代码
2018/01/08 Javascript
Node.js中的不安全跳转如何防御详解
2018/10/21 Javascript
tracking.js实现前端人脸识别功能
2020/04/16 Javascript
vue 内联样式style中的background用法说明
2020/08/05 Javascript
Vue利用localStorage本地缓存使页面刷新验证码不清零功能的实现
2020/09/04 Javascript
Python批量转换文件编码格式
2015/05/17 Python
python中__call__内置函数用法实例
2015/06/04 Python
CentOS中使用virtualenv搭建python3环境
2015/06/08 Python
NumPy 数学函数及代数运算的实现代码
2018/07/18 Python
python监控进程状态,记录重启时间及进程号的实例
2019/07/15 Python
使用python获取邮箱邮件的设置方法
2019/09/20 Python
Python异常处理机制结构实例解析
2020/07/23 Python
用python实现前向分词最大匹配算法的示例代码
2020/08/06 Python
css3实现input输入框颜色渐变发光效果代码
2014/04/02 HTML / CSS
品质主管的岗位职责
2013/12/04 职场文书
皮肤科医师岗位职责
2013/12/04 职场文书
《狐假虎威》教学反思
2014/02/07 职场文书
廉政文化进校园广播稿
2014/10/20 职场文书
收费员岗位职责
2015/02/14 职场文书
干部培训工作总结2015
2015/05/25 职场文书
爱心捐赠活动简讯
2015/07/20 职场文书
2015年入党积极分子培养考察意见
2015/08/12 职场文书
爱国之歌(8首)
2019/09/29 职场文书
Nginx 过滤静态资源文件的访问日志的实现
2021/03/31 Servers
PyQt5实现多张图片显示并滚动
2021/06/11 Python